首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我想在公文包上显示和共享我的React.js应用程序

React.js是一个用于构建用户界面的JavaScript库。它由Facebook开发并开源,已经成为前端开发中最受欢迎的框架之一。

React.js的主要特点包括:

  1. 组件化:React.js将用户界面拆分为独立的组件,每个组件都有自己的状态和属性。这种组件化的开发方式使得代码更加模块化、可复用,并且易于维护。
  2. 虚拟DOM:React.js使用虚拟DOM来管理页面上的元素,通过比较虚拟DOM的差异来高效地更新页面。这种方式可以减少对实际DOM的操作,提高性能。
  3. 单向数据流:React.js采用单向数据流的数据绑定方式,父组件可以通过属性将数据传递给子组件,子组件不能直接修改父组件的数据。这种数据流的设计使得应用程序的状态更加可控,易于调试。

React.js的应用场景非常广泛,包括但不限于:

  1. Web应用程序:React.js可以用于构建各种类型的Web应用程序,从简单的静态页面到复杂的单页应用。
  2. 移动应用程序:React Native是基于React.js的移动应用开发框架,可以用于开发iOS和Android应用程序。
  3. 桌面应用程序:Electron是一个使用Web技术构建跨平台桌面应用程序的框架,它使用React.js作为界面的开发工具。

腾讯云提供了一系列与React.js相关的产品和服务,包括:

  1. 云服务器(CVM):提供了可靠的云服务器实例,可以用于部署React.js应用程序。
  2. 云存储(COS):提供了高可靠、低成本的对象存储服务,可以用于存储React.js应用程序的静态资源。
  3. 云数据库MySQL版(CMYSQL):提供了高性能、可扩展的关系型数据库服务,可以用于存储React.js应用程序的数据。
  4. 云函数(SCF):提供了无服务器的函数计算服务,可以用于构建React.js应用程序的后端逻辑。

更多关于腾讯云产品和服务的详细介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

面试完以后,想在这里对程序员招聘一些吐槽建议

在邮件列表论坛发布“请给我写好代码”帖子的人,其实不差;更有可能他们受到教育建基于背诵应试。另外如果你从没读过著名物理学家费曼造访一所采用这个方法大学故事,强烈推荐它。...与此同时另一方面,在合作过技术牛人当中,大多数根本没有软件工程计算机科学大学背景;很多人直到快上完学才第一次写代码( 不要脸偏见:直到快大学毕业才开始通常意义上“编程”,也是在毕业几年后才开始以此谋生...而且如果他们能学会拆解 A 线诗歌,基本就能确认他们能用你 JavaScript 框架写出一个 CRUD 应用程序,因为那个 JavaScript 框架上周才发布,所以根本没有多少人拥有超过一两天...能说是,你并不是一个人。自身傲慢想要赶紧完事然后往下继续不耐烦,是在那次面试失败主因。...知道理论上这种非人性化脱节,是太多人申请技术岗位副作用;让流程人性化处理所有申请,这两者不可兼得。但这肯定会让求职者充满苦涩。

71240
  • 2023 年前端十大 Web 发展趋势

    虽然不少开发者都对 Next.js React.js 之间过于“亲密”关系颇有微词,但 React.js 并非不可替代。...Vercel SolidStart(基于 Solid.js 构建)提供支持,较 React.js 拥有更好开发者体验。...这些包可以在各种应用程序中直接导入:使用所有共享实际应用程序(例如 app.mywebsite.com 客户端渲染)、仅使用共享设计系统包且考虑 SEO 需求主页 / 产品 / 登陆页面(例如由服务器端渲染或静态站点生成...mywebsite.com),以及使用共享 UI 组件共享设计系统包技术文档页面(例如 docs.mywebsite.com)。...如果您已经使用了前端后端共享代码 TypeScript Monorepo,tRPC 允许大家将所有类型从后端导出至前端应用程序,过程中无需生成任何类型化 schema。

    3K20

    如何在 2022 年为 Web 应用程序选择技术堆栈

    在本文中,将帮助您选择最有效 Web 开发技术栈。 将解释哪些技术可供选择,它们优点缺点,并告知您哪些技术适合不同项目。还将就如何选择正确技术堆栈提供有价值建议。 什么是技术堆栈?...客户端是用户可以在其显示器上看到可视化数据。它包括以下组件: 编程语言,负责 Web 应用程序交互部分, 在浏览器中显示网站内容文档标记语言, 用于描述文档表示样式表语言, 用户界面框架。...例如,对于小型单页网站,Node.jsReact.js堆栈将完成这项工作。中等规模 Web 应用程序(例如购物网站)需要更复杂技术堆栈、多个级别的编程语言和多个框架。...框架 Web 开发最常见前端框架是 React.js、Angular.js Vue.js。 React.js是一个免费开源前端 JavaScript 库,用于构建用户界面。...该框架非常适合复杂、高级 Web 应用程序。如果你想在 Angular 上构建一个 Web 应用程序,你需要在开发开始之前就对其进行彻底规划。

    87230

    不认为Flutter比React Native好

    没准你公司正在网站、Web 应用程序或者服务器当中使用 React.js,或者至少在用 JavaScript。...这种在 React.js 应用程序、Node 服务器等场景之间共享代码能力,正是 React Native 最引以为傲资本——相比之下,Flutter 就明显弱一些。...另一方面,无论大家是用 React Native 开发 Web 应用程序、还是直接选择 React.js,React Native 都能直接共享代码。...通过 JavaScript/Typescript 共享服务与模块,开发者能够轻松共享大量业务逻辑、数据模型等,并在 Web 应用程序中拆分并直接共享 UI 组件。...总之,希望尽可能在文章中公平讨论这个问题。 也不关注那些什么美学、优雅层面的问题,例如 Dart TypeScript 语法、或者 JSX Dart 功能部件结构谁更好之类。

    2.5K20

    2018年Web开发人员应该学习12个框架

    在本文中,分享了12个与Java开发,移动应用程序开发,Web开发大数据相关有用框架。 1)Angular 2+ 这是另一个JavaScript框架,它在2018年要学习东西列表中。...如果你决定在2018年学习React,那么PluarlsightReact.js:Getting Started课程是一个很好起点。...如果你想在2018年学习Cordova,那么请查看Build iOSAngularCordova。...12)Xamarin Xamarin是一种通过单个共享C#代码库为所有平台快速制作移动应用程序方法,为每个平台构建自定义本机用户界面,或使用Xamarin.Forms跨平台编写单个共享用户界面。...如果你已经了解C语言之一并且正在寻找移动应用程序开发职业,那么强烈建议你在2018年学习Xamarin,以及完整Xamarin开发人员课程:iOSAndroid!是一个很好课程开始。

    5.5K40

    《从零开始学ASP.NET CORE MVC》:VS2019创建ASP.NET Core Web程序(三)

    将把项目放在,路径为,C:\Projects\source\repos 文件夹中。 第6步:点击创建按钮。 ? 此处步骤VS 2017不太相同。...此屏幕显示可用于创建ASP.NET Core应用程序不同项目模板。 各个模板简单说明 空:名称暗示“空”模板不包含任何内容。...下面的屏幕截图显示使用Web应用程序(模型视图控制器)创建项目。请注意,我们有Modes,ViewsControllers文件夹。...它不会创建 Models Views文件夹,因为它们不是API所必需。下面的屏幕截图显示使用API模板创建项目。请注意,我们只有Controllers文件夹。...Angular,React.jsReact.jsRedux:这三个模板允许我们与Angular,React或ReactRedux一起创建asp.net Core Web应用程序

    3.9K20

    大纲笔记软件 Workflowy 综合评测:优点、缺点评价

    Workflowy介绍大纲编辑器鼻祖。特征捕捉一切Workflowy 速度极快,只需打开应用程序并开始输入。在线拖放文件,无需切换应用程序。支持轻松添加文件图片,支持全局搜索、支持移动端应用。...折叠不重要细节并仅显示当前重要内容。包括无限嵌套、展开 + 折叠、反向链接等功能;即时分享极其简单共享权限让您可以控制谁可以看到什么,并轻松与任何人协作。他们甚至不需要帐户即可查看或编辑项目。...,详细介绍了大纲编辑器优点缺点。...如今,是使用大纲编辑器收集整理信息,而使用 Notion 类应用 FlowUs 存储分享知识。...像网盘应用一样,FlowUs 允许用户将自己常用公文件以文件夹或者多个文件形式一键上传至笔记空间之中。并且,FlowUs 允许用户免费在线预览文件夹页面中公文件。

    1.6K00

    《从零开始学ASP.NET CORE MVC》:VS2017创建ASP.NET Core Web程序(三)

    此屏幕显示可用于创建ASP.NET Core应用程序不同项目模板。 各个模板简单说明 空:名称暗示“空”模板不包含任何内容。...下面的屏幕截图显示使用Web应用程序(模型视图控制器)创建项目。请注意,我们有Modes,ViewsControllers文件夹。...它不会创建 Models Views文件夹,因为它们不是API所必需。下面的屏幕截图显示使用API模板创建项目。请注意,我们只有Controllers文件夹。...Angular,React.jsReact.jsRedux:这三个模板允许我们与Angular,React或ReactRedux一起创建asp.net Core Web应用程序。...在下一篇文章中,我们将探索理解ASP.NET Core 项目文件。 摘要 在本文中,尝试解释如何使用从头开始创建项目,以及不同类型模板区别。希望这篇文章可以帮助您满足您需求。

    2.8K30

    优化 React.js 页面性能:最佳实践技术

    React.js 应用性能优化重要性性能优化对 React.js 应用程序至关重要,它可以显著提高用户体验并增强整个应用成功。...准确识别性能瓶颈重要性。第二部分:提高 React.js 性能技术使用 PureComponent React.memo:这些组件如何帮助防止不必要重新渲染。提供代码示例演示它们用法。...:解释 React.js 中代码拆分延迟加载好处。...、React DevTools、Lighthouse)用于分析调试 React.js 应用程序。...结论:总结博客中讨论关键点。鼓励开发人员优先考虑 React.js 应用程序性能优化,以提供更好用户体验。正在参与2023腾讯技术创作特训营第三期有奖征文,组队打卡瓜分大奖!

    14100

    前端对决:ReactJSX与Vuetemplates

    React.jsVue.js是这个星球上最流行JavaScript库。它们都很强大,相对来说很容易获取使用。 ReactVue共性: 使用虚拟DOM。 提供响应式视图组件。...现在有一个简单React应用程序,它将显示名称列表。没有什么可以写,但它应该能让你了解React能力是什么。 特别说明下,react.js相关课程可以点击这里。...Vue.js Templates(模板) 按照最后一个示例,您将再次创建一个简单应用程序,它将在浏览器上显示名称列表。 你需要做第一件事就是创建一个空index.html文件。...现在,每当您想在应用程序中使用该数据集时,只需要使用指令调用它。很简单,对吧?...无论哪种方式,VueReact都是两个功能强大库,你使用任何一个都不会有问题。 如果你觉得这篇文章很有帮助,给我一些掌声。 你可以在Twitter上跟踪

    2.4K20

    Puter:开源免费一键部署个人云电脑,随时随地畅享云端操作系统

    一站式个人云平台 Puter 为你提供了一个集中管理文件、应用、游戏云平台。无论是办公文件、应用程序,还是大型游戏,Puter 都能够轻松保存、快速访问,真正做到“一站式管理”。 2....用户不仅可以通过它进行应用构建,还能够发布测试网站、Web 应用程序,甚至是游戏,极大提升开发效率。 4....、表格等办公任务,减少对本地电脑依赖; • 数据存储与共享:作为私有网盘解决方案,实现文件高效安全存储访问。...当然,如果想在本地直接体验,部署也非常简单。...,凭借高度自定义选项完全自主隐私保护,为用户提供了一个随时随地、全面安全云端操作体验。

    38720

    office2021安装包下载地址,以及后面的安装步骤教程

    它既能够在个人计算机上单独用到,也能够用作企业中协作辅助工具用到Microsoft Office,消费者能够创立、撰稿分享各种各样类型公文格式、撰稿器交互式原稿其中,Word能够创立撰稿各种各样类型公文格式...,Excel主要用于创立管理复杂统计数据申请表图象,PowerPoint主要用于创立展示各种各样类型交互式原稿。...除此之外,Microsoft Office还提供了一些高级特性,例如共享公文格式、在线协作、云端存储等,这些特性能够希望消费者更方便快捷地管理共享公文同时,Microsoft Office还能够借由软件包方式扩展其特性...点击 ->下载安装资源1、 双击锁上office应用程序。 2、耐心等待片刻出现左图正在装设界面。3、装设再行后,如左图,点击关停即可。4、iTunesoffice365后放在桌面,然后运行。...、申请表等元素,使公文格式更丰富生动。

    44030

    React.jsVue.js语法并列比较

    React.jsVue.js都是很好框架。而且Next.jsNuxt.js甚至将它们带入了一个新高度,这有助于我们以更少配置更好可维护性来创建应用程序。...但是,如果你必须经常在框架之间切换,在深入探讨另一个框架之后,你可能会轻易忘记另一个框架中语法。在本文中,总结了这些框架基本语法方案,然后并排列出。...希望这可以帮助我们尽快掌握语法,不过限于篇幅,这篇文章只比较React.jsVue.js,下一篇再谈Next.js个Nuxt.js。 ?...button onClick={() => handleDelete(item)}>{item.name}; /* * 应用useCallback钩子来防止在每次渲染时生成新函数...React.Component { state = { hasError: false }; static getDerivedStateFromError(error) { // 更新状态,这样下一个渲染将显示回退

    10.5K20

    7个好用又有趣Python工具包,你一定要试试

    所以,今天挑选了7个好用又有趣软件包,介绍它们功能特点,大家感兴趣可以继续看下去,下面所列举有没有踩中你心中。 1....Dash Dash是比较新软件包,它是用纯Python构建数据可视化app理想选择,因此特别适合处理数据任何人。Dash是Flask,Plotly.jsReact.js混合体。 2....Pillow Pillow专门用于处理图像,您可以使用该库创建缩略图,在文件格式之间转换,旋转,应用滤镜,显示图像等等。如果您需要对许多图像执行批量操作,这是理想选择。...IPython是Jupyter Notebook核心,它是一个开放源代码Web应用程序,可让您创建和共享包含实时代码,方程式,可视化效果叙述文本文档。 5....如果您知道自己将开发一个大型Web应用程序,则可能需要研究一个更完整框架。该类别中最受欢迎是Django。 以上,就是列举几个工具包。如果大家还有其他补充或不同意见可以在评论处进行讨论!

    1.2K50

    React.js vs. Angular

    ❤️ 随着前端开发快速发展,开发人员现在有了更多选择来构建现代、交互式Web应用程序。在这个前端框架之争时代,Vue.js、React.jsAngular是三个最受欢迎选择。...有许多第三方库工具,例如React Router、Redux等,可以帮助开发者构建强大Web应用程序。 适用场景 React.js适用于各种规模项目,包括大型应用程序。...对于中型到大型项目,React.jsAngular都提供了更多工具结构,有助于处理复杂性。 生态系统 如果您需要大量第三方库工具支持,React.jsAngular都有庞大生态系统。...如果您希望提高团队技能水平,学习新框架可能是一个好机会。 性能需求 如果您应用程序需要高性能,React.js虚拟DOM机制可能是一个优势。...Angular也提供了良好性能,但它可能会更适合处理大型应用程序数据流。 结论 在Vue.js、React.jsAngular之间进行选择是一个重要决策,它将影响项目的发展维护。

    52610

    layui弹出层html,layer弹出层「建议收藏」

    大家好,又见面了,是你们朋友全栈君。 layer 弹出层,怎么只让他弹出一次.在线等 昨天用这个插件时候也有这个问题,弹出内容大了就居不了中。...这是组件不完美的地方,他设置了topleft值,而且是固定。这种弹出层都是绝对定位 所以没办法用margin:auto 0神马居中。解决方案主要两种: 1.修改在浏览器里面调试模式。...我们想在弹出层里提交form表单后关闭弹出层,并跳转到另一个画面。 引用layer.js后 弹窗为什么会在页面最底部出现 这个要看layer中content内容了 /。...即id=wrapper下DIV 刚好今天也遇到这个问题,摸索了几个小时,搞定了,关键语法如下: layer.open({ type: 1, content: (‘#id’) //这里content是一个...弹出层位于手机页layer.alert(‘您有一条新公文信息,请前往查阅’, { title:’公文提醒’, offset: ‘rb’, anim: 2, shade:false }); 为什么layer

    19.1K30

    如何入侵Linux操作系统

    因为被它开端口吸引住了,它开着WWW,就不信它不出错。一连拿了五种CGIWWW扫描器总计扫了三四百种常见错误它几乎都不存在。:( 有几个错误,但我不知道如何利用,算了。...在上网机器上开着WINDOWS“文件打印机共享服务,是很多人容易掉以轻心,这个root没有例外。...如果它C盘共享了而且可写那就好了,但那是做梦,现在开了共享目录没有一个是根目录,连D驱都没有。别着急,慢慢来。x掉那些文件夹都没用,不能写,里面尽是些英文原著,这个root还挺行。...“公文包”吸引了注意,这是一个用于将不同机器上资料进行同步工具,很显然这个root要经常更新主机上主页,有时候在自己机器上编,有时候在主机上编……所以很重要一点:“公文包”共享一般都是可写...  >attrib +h X月工作计划.bat   这样,root公文包”里只剩下一个原来一模一样WORD图标,他做梦也没想到这已变成了一个BAT文件。

    10210

    win10 uwp 简单MasterDetail UWP 导航List点击后退按钮页面更改大小修改显示修改代码源码左右列表内容相互操作

    中文 English 本文主要讲实现一个简单界面,可以在窗口比较大显示列表内容,窗口比较小时候显示列表或内容。也就是在窗口比较小时候,点击列表会显示内容,点击返回会显示列表。 先放图,很简单。...本文是很简单,一般和我一样渣都能大概知道。 代码是在很大压力会议上写,不到一个钟,写完修改,大家说。很简单,可以修改代码,可以自己写,下面来说下如何写。...我们可以使用顺序,对,ListContentZindex就是设置他们位置,Zindex比较大显示,也就是判断是否存在Content,存在就显示他,不存在,显示List。...如果屏幕小,那么使用ListContent放在同一个Grid,依靠Zindex显示,如果是需要显示列表就列表ZIndex大,需要显示内容,就把内容ZIndex大。...x:Bind,要OneWay 写 List 需要使用 Grid 控制他位置背景,因为 List 背景透明,其实在 List 也可以用背景,但是想我会在 List 做弹出,最后想着用 Grid

    1.9K00
    领券